Caergwrle

Caergwrle is a Village in the county of Flintshire (Sir y Fflint).

There are great places to visit near Caergwrle including some great towns, castles, ruins, hills, ancient sites, hiking areas and country parks.

There are a several good towns in the Caergwrle area like Buckley, and Flint.

The area around Caergwrle's best castles can be found at Flint Castle - Castell y Fflint.

Don't miss Flint Castle - Castell y Fflint's ruins if visiting the area around Caergwrle.

There are a several good hills in the Caergwrle area like Clwydian Range, Moel Famau, Moel Llys-y-Coed, Moel Arthur, and Hope Mountain.

There are a number of ancient sites near to Caergwrle including Moel Arthur.

Places near Caergwrle feature a number of interesting hiking areas including Hope Mountain.

Caergwrle is near some unmissable country parks like Waun-Y-Llyn Country Park,
